DOGE: The Hype-Driven Rollercoaster
Dogecoin's price in September 2025 hovers near $0.27, buoyed by whale accumulation and the launch of its first ETF on September 18[1]. Technical indicators suggest a moderate bullish bias, with key resistance at $0.285 and support near $0.26[2]. However, DOGE's volatility remains pronounced, with a 4.19% single-day drop in July 2025 illustrating the fragility of its momentum[3]. Analysts caution that DOGE's future hinges on broader crypto cycles and institutional adoption, yet its lack of tangible utility leaves it exposed to sentiment-driven swings[4].
Behavioral finance principles are deeply embedded in DOGE's narrative. FOMO and herd mentality drive retail investors to chase price surges fueled by viral social media trends and celebrity endorsements[5]. For instance, the 52% Q3 2025 surge was amplified by algorithmically curated content on TikTok and Reddit, creating echo chambers that reinforce bullish bias[6]. Overconfidence bias further exacerbates risks, as investors overlook fundamental weaknesses like inflationary supply and dependency on Elon Musk's influence[7].
RTX: The Utility-Driven Contender
Remittix (RTX), priced at $0.0628 in September 2025, has raised $20.7 million in its presale, selling 669 million tokens[8]. Its real-world utility—enabling instant cross-border payments to 30+ countries—positions it as a “next XRP” in the $190 trillion remittance industry[9]. RTX's deflationary tokenomics and BitMart listing in September 2025[10] have attracted investors seeking long-term value, contrasting with DOGE's speculative allure.
Behavioral dynamics for RTX are shaped by confirmation bias and herding, but with a utility-centric twist. Social media campaigns on X and Reddit amplify RTX's narrative, with investors fixating on its low gas fees and PayFi infrastructure[11]. Unlike DOGEDOGE--, RTX's growth is less reliant on viral hype and more on tangible use cases, reducing exposure to sentiment-driven corrections[12]. However, overconfidence in its potential to reach $2 by 2026[13] could lead to over-leveraged positions if adoption lags expectations.
